    Finally! I did the netsh windsock reset, reinstalled java, reinstalled Flash (which runs in both 32 and 64 bit versions of IE8) in both and Shockwave (which only runs in 32bit version) in 32 bit IE8 and now so long as I use the 32 bit IE8 both work.
